Texto da carta

Como um custo adicional para conjurar Fenda de Magma, sacrifique um terreno. Fenda de Magma causa 5 pontos de dano à criatura alvo.

"Para acender um fogo são necessários gravetos e calor. Os gravetos serão você. Eu cuido do calor." — Chandra Nalaar
